Zirconia ceramic polishing method: Zirconia ceramic has high high-temperature structural strength and negative resistance temperature coefficient, so it is necessary to polish the material of the product under certain circumstances. The specific methods are as follows:

(1) Mechanical polishing of zirconia ceramics: In order to improve work efficiency during large-scale construction of zirconia ceramics, mechanical polishing methods such as electric polishing machines (disc type, vibration type) can be used.

(2) Dry polishing of zirconia ceramics: sandpaper is used for polishing. Suitable for polishing hard and brittle paint, the disadvantage of polishing zirconia ceramic materials is that a lot of dust will be generated during the operation, which affects environmental hygiene.

(3) Wet polishing of zirconia ceramics: Use sandpaper dipped in water or soapy water to polish. Water grinding can reduce grinding marks, improve the smoothness of coatings, and save sandpaper and labor. However, attention should be paid to spraying the lower layer of paint after water grinding. Firstly, it is necessary to wait for the water grinding layer to completely dry before applying the lower layer of paint, otherwise the paint layer can easily turn white. Additionally, substrates with strong water absorption are not suitable for water grinding.

Cooling and shaping of zirconia ceramic structural components

(1) Zirconia ceramic vacuum cooling and shaping: The method of using vacuum outside the pipe to adsorb the outer surface of the pipe on the inner wall of the shaping sleeve and cooling to determine the outer diameter size is used. This method is particularly suitable for the extrusion method of ultra-high molecular weight polyethylene ceramic needle gauge structural components.

(2) Zirconia ceramic internal pressure cooling and shaping: It is a method of using compressed air inside the zirconia ceramic structural component, and adding a cooling and shaping sleeve to the pipe, so that the outer surface of the pipe is attached to the shaping sleeve and quickly cooled and hardened to determine the outer size. The pipe is evenly drawn out through a traction device.

(3) Zirconia ceramic sizing port sizing (ejection method) cooling shaping: This method does not require a traction device and directly ejects the zirconia ceramic structural component into shape. The characteristics of the ejection method head structure are: the straight part of the core mold is about 10-50mm longer than the mouth mold, and the screw thrust pushes the pipe out of the head and directly into the cooling water tank. The outer surface of the pipe cools and hardens, and the inner surface is covered on the core rod and cannot shrink inward to shape.
